Missed Follow-ups for Consulting Call Center Managers

In the high-stakes world of consulting, where precision and timely communication are paramount, missing follow-ups can equate to missed revenue opportunities. Studies show that sales teams often lose about 27% of potential deals due to inadequate follow-up, with prospects typically needing 5 to 12 interactions before committing to a purchase. This is particularly crucial for consulting firms, where each lead represents a unique opportunity for a long-term partnership. When follow-ups are missed, leads rapidly grow cold, and competitors quickly capitalize on these lapses, effectively capturing business that should have been secured. Addressing this issue is not just about maintaining a good lead pipeline; it's about safeguarding your firm's competitive edge and ensuring sustained growth in a saturated market.

Frequently Asked Questions

How can missed follow-ups impact client relationships in consulting?

Missed follow-ups can signal disorganization or lack of interest, damaging trust and credibility. This is critical in consulting, where relationships are built on expertise and reliability. Consistent communication is key to nurturing these bonds.

Why are automated solutions essential for managing follow-ups in consulting?

Automated solutions ensure that no client interaction falls through the cracks, providing timely and personalized follow-ups. This is essential in consulting, where each interaction can significantly influence decision-making processes and outcomes.

What specific challenges do consulting firms face in follow-up processes?

Consulting firms deal with complex client accounts that require tailored communication strategies. Traditional follow-up methods often lack the scalability and customization needed to meet these demands, leading to inefficient communication.
